No
How's that for concise, Bill?
The EG33 uses a sidefeed design, while the Imprezas use a top feed design. A new fuel rail would be the easiest way to utilize the top-feed units. A bunch of people talk about the Nissan/Infiniti side feed designs, but as far as I know based on this site, only cdigerlando has actually tried to fit them. Search some of his posts on Silvia fule injectors or Nissan fuel injectors. Todd PS-Getting together with the NASIOC guys can really help determine what works and what won't with our cars.
